Social License And Environmental Protection: Why Businesses Go Beyond Compliance, Neil Gunningham, Robert Kagan, Dorothy Thornton

This article examines the concept of the corporate "social license," which governs the extent to which a corporation is constrained to meet societal expectations & avoid activities that societies (or influential elements within them) deem unacceptable, whether or not those expectations are embodied in law. It examines the social license empirically, as it relates to one social problem -- environmental protection -- & as it relates to one particular industry: pulp & paper manufacturing.
